Chadeffect, to be honest, no, I haven't found anything that presents depth and width. I've also noticed that the more depth I get in a soundstage the narrower it gets, and bringing the stage more forward increases the stage width and height. I did find at one point my stage got too deep, I felt like the band was out in my driveway. I was able to move several rows forward by placing a DCCA Reference Master on my power conditioner. However, for the most part I like a deep, 3-D presentation, say around row 12.

It's all a matter of balance, you may just want to change one cord to move forward or back. It sounds like you want to move even more forward, are you using all VD cables and cords? If not, try adding some more.

FWIW, it may be hard to believe, but the Stealth cables/cords will provide more detail and air in the high's. However, if you feel that your dcS already is providing great high's with the VD, the Stealth may be too much of a good thing. I do know some who find the Stealth sonic signature 'bright'. My system is a bit on the warm side, so the more abundant detail of the Stealth is well appreciated here.

I felt I should report back some findings. Though it is still early days burning in wise. Sorry to mess up this thread but...

The VD LE compared to my Analysis Golden oval is definitely more dynamic and robust in the bass. In fact the bass must be the best I have heard. Its electrifying. But the AP Golden oval is much more transparent in the highs and midrange with better soundstage depth, but seeming to roll off as you get into the bass frequencies. I wonder if this is similar to the Stealth?

If only there was a cable that took the best of the AP golden Oval and the VD! That would be the end of it. It is very frustrating.
